The Golden Rule: Never Let Timers Cap
If you have four chest slots and all of them are locked, any victories you achieve on the ladder are technically 'wasted' from an economic perspective.

Save the massive, eight-hour or twelve-hour magical chests to unlock right before you go to sleep at night.

Most games provide a set of three to five daily quests that reward tokens, gold, or specific cards.

Instead, use the unranked 'Party' modes or friendly clan battles to quickly farm these specific objectives without risking trophies.
